Course Content

• Employee Retention Strategies in Mergers & Acquisitions
• Cultural Integration & Change Management in Consumer Goods
• Talent Assessment & Retention Planning (Post-M&A)
• Compensation & Benefits Strategies for Retained Employees
• Communication & Engagement During the M&A Process
• Leadership Development & Succession Planning (Consumer Goods)
• Risk Management & Legal Considerations in Employee Retention
• Measuring the Success of Employee Retention Initiatives
• Best Practices in Consumer Goods M&A Employee Retention

UK Consumer Goods M&A: Employee Retention Landscape

Career Role (Primary: Retention Specialist; Secondary: Talent Acquisition) Description
Senior Retention Manager (Consumer Goods) Develops and implements strategic retention initiatives for key talent within the consumer goods sector post-M&A, focusing on employee engagement and satisfaction.
Talent Acquisition Specialist (M&A Integration) Manages the talent acquisition process during and after mergers and acquisitions, ensuring seamless integration and minimizing talent loss within consumer goods companies. Focuses on candidate experience and retention strategies.
Compensation & Benefits Analyst (Retention Focused) Analyzes compensation and benefits packages to identify areas for improvement to enhance employee retention within the consumer goods industry following an M&A event.
HR Business Partner (Employee Retention) Acts as a strategic advisor to leadership, providing insights and recommendations to improve employee retention across various departments within consumer goods companies undergoing M&A.
